MySQL中为所有字段插入记录时,省略字段名称,必须严格按照数据表结构插入对应的值
暂无解析
举一反三
- 当使用采用insert into 表名(‘字段1’,’字段2’,…) values(‘值1’,’值2’,…) 语句时,如果向表中的部分列插入数据,则相应的字段名表不能省略;如果向表中所有列插入数据且字段顺序与表结构相同,则字段名可以省略。
- 当用insert语句向表的所有字段插入值时,字段名可以省略。 A: 错 B: 对
- 同时插入多条记录时,语法格式为: insert into 表名(字段名列表) values(字段值列表1),(字段值列表2),……,(字段值列表n);
- 某个表有两个字段,使用insert语句插入数据正确的是() A: insert into 表名 values(字段名1对应的值); B: insert into 表名(字段1,字段2) values(字段名1对应的值,字段名2对应值); C: insert into 表名(字段名1) value (字段名1对应的值); D: insert into 表名(字段名1,字段名2) values(字段名2对应的值,字段名1对应值);
- 在MySQL 中,默认约束用于给数据表中的字段指定默认值,插入记录时,如果这个字段没有给定值,将使用默认值。
内容
- 0
在MySql数据库中,可以通过不指定字段名的方式为表插入记录。其基本语句形式如下:INSERTINTO表名VALUES(值1,值2值n),下列描述错误的是哪个() A: “表名”参数指定记录插入到哪个表中;“值n”参数表示要插入的数据 B: 表中定义了几个字段,INSERT语句中就必须而且一定应该对应有几个值 C: 插入的顺序与表中字段的顺序一定必须相同 D: 因为MYSQL是弱类型的数据库,所以取值的数据类型可以不和表中对应字段的数据类型一致
- 1
下列MySQL命令中,可以实现更新记录的命令有()。 A: update 数据表参照关系 set 字段名称=值, [where 条件] [group by 字段名称] B: update 数据表,数据表, set 字段名称=值,where 条件 C: update 数据表 set 字段名称=值,[where 条件] D: update 数据表 set 字段名称=值, [where 条件] [order by 字段名称]
- 2
下列哪一项不属于表结构的修改(). A: 插入字段 B: 删除字段 C: 修改字段名 D: 增加一条记录
- 3
为数据表添加数据记录时,以下字段必须输入值________
- 4
使用语句向数据表的所有字段中插入数据。A.insert